-
जावास्क्रिप्ट में निरपेक्ष मान योग न्यूनीकरण
मान लीजिए, हमें पूर्णांकों की एक क्रमबद्ध सरणी दी गई है, आइए हम इसे arr कहते हैं। हमें ऐसा पूर्णांक x ज्ञात करना है कि − . का मान abs(a[0] - x) + abs(a[1] - x) + ... + abs(a[a.length - 1] - x) सबसे छोटा संभव है (यहाँ एब्स निरपेक्ष मान को दर्शाता है)। यदि कई संभावित उत्तर हैं, तो सबसे छोटा उत्तर दें
-
स्ट्रिंग विधियों का उपयोग किए बिना और जावास्क्रिप्ट में सरणियों का उपयोग किए बिना एक पूर्णांक को छाँटना
हमें एक JavaScript फ़ंक्शन लिखना है जो एक संख्या लेता है। फ़ंक्शन को सबसे छोटी संख्या लौटानी चाहिए जिसे संख्या के अंकों को पुनर्व्यवस्थित करके बनाया जा सकता है। उदाहरण के लिए - अगर इनपुट नंबर है - const num = 614532; तब आउटपुट होना चाहिए - const output = 123456; एकमात्र शर्त यह है कि हम डेटा को
-
किसी संख्या का तब तक योग करें जब तक कि वह 1 अंक का JavaScript न बन जाए
हमें एक JavaScript फ़ंक्शन लिखने की आवश्यकता है जो केवल इनपुट के रूप में एक संख्या लेता है। फ़ंक्शन को एक साधारण काम करना चाहिए - परिणामी अंकों को तब तक जोड़ते रहें जब तक कि वे एक अंक की संख्या में न बदल जाएं। उदाहरण के लिए - const num = 5798; यानी 5 + 7 + 9 + 8 = 29 2 + 9 = 11 1 + 1 = 2 इसल
-
पूर्णांकों की एक सरणी को देखते हुए सकारात्मक लौटाते हैं, जिनके समकक्ष नकारात्मक जावास्क्रिप्ट में मौजूद हैं
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ो संख्याओं की एक सरणी (सकारात्मक और नकारात्मक दोनों) लेता है। फ़ंक्शन को सरणी से उन सभी सकारात्मक संख्याओं की एक सरणी वापस करनी चाहिए जिनके नकारात्मक समकक्ष सरणी में मौजूद हैं। उदाहरण के लिए:यदि इनपुट ऐरे है - const arr = [1, 5, −3, −5, 3, 2]; त
-
जावास्क्रिप्ट में गैर-ऋणात्मक सेट घटाव
हमारे पास पूर्णांकों का एक सेट है, और एक मान है जिसे हमें समुच्चय के योग से घटाना है। यहाँ की तरह, [4, 5, 6, 7, 8] - 25 यदि हम प्रत्येक संख्या में से समान रूप से घटाते हैं, तो हमें - . प्राप्त होगा [−1, 0, 1, 2, 3] हालांकि, हमें 0 से कम की कोई संख्या नहीं चाहिए। इसलिए, यदि हम ऐसा करने के लिए एक
-
जावास्क्रिप्ट में वांछित संयोजन उत्पन्न करना
फ़ंक्शन को m संख्याओं के सभी संभावित संयोजनों को खोजना चाहिए जो एक संख्या n तक जोड़ते हैं, यह देखते हुए कि केवल 1 से 9 तक की संख्याओं का उपयोग किया जा सकता है और प्रत्येक संयोजन संख्याओं का एक अद्वितीय सेट होना चाहिए। उदाहरण के लिए - यदि इनपुट हैं - const m = 3, n = 4; तब आउटपुट होना चाहिए - const
-
जावास्क्रिप्ट में शब्दों को तोड़े बिना वाक्य को निश्चित लंबाई के ब्लॉक में कैसे विभाजित करें
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ना आवश्यक है जो एक स्ट्रिंग लेता है जिसमें पैराग्राफ का टेक्स्ट पहले तर्क के रूप में होता है और दूसरे तर्क के रूप में एक खंड आकार संख्या होती है। फ़ंक्शन को निम्न चीज़ें करनी चाहिए - स्ट्रिंग को लंबाई के टुकड़ों में तोड़ें जो खंड आकार (दूसरा तर्क) से अधिक न हो,
-
जावास्क्रिप्ट में सभी गुणकों का योग
हमें एक JavaScript फ़ंक्शन लिखने की आवश्यकता है जो पहले तर्क के रूप में एक संख्या लेता है, जैसे n, और फिर उसके बाद कितनी भी संख्या में तर्क। विचार n तक की सभी संख्याओं का योग करना है जो दूसरे तर्क और उसके बाद निर्दिष्ट किसी भी संख्या से विभाजित हैं। उदाहरण के लिए - यदि फ़ंक्शन को इस तरह कहा जाता
-
जावास्क्रिप्ट में वर्ग के योग और योग के वर्ग के बीच अंतर
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खने की आवश्यकता है जो एक संख्या लेता है, मान लीजिए n, एक और एकमात्र इनपुट के रूप में। समारोह चाहिए - पहली n प्राकृत संख्याओं के वर्गों के योग की गणना करें। पहली n प्राकृत संख्याओं के योग के वर्ग की गणना करें। प्राप्त दोनों आंकड़ों के बीच पूर्ण अंतर लौटाएं।
-
जावास्क्रिप्ट में एक स्ट्रिंग के भीतर अक्षरों को क्रमबद्ध करना
मान लीजिए, हमारे पास इस तरह के शब्दों की एक अल्पविराम से अलग की गई स्ट्रिंग है - const str = 'JAY, ROB'; ह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ो एक ऐसी स्ट्रिंग लेता है। फ़ंक्शन स्ट्रिंग में शब्दों से एक नया शब्द बना सकता है जहां पूर्ववर्ती वर्णमाला हमेशा अगले के बराबर से अधिक होती है (उद
-
शिफ्ट स्ट्रिंग्स जावास्क्रिप्ट में बाएं और दाएं परिपत्र
हमें एक JavaScript फ़ंक्शन लिखने की आवश्यकता है जो तीन तर्कों को लेता है, पहला एक स्ट्रिंग है, मान लीजिए str, फिर हमारे पास दो संख्याएँ हैं, मान लीजिए m और n। संख्याएं एम और एन मूल रूप से क्रमशः बाएं और दाएं शिफ्ट की मात्रा निर्दिष्ट करती हैं। हम इन शब्दों को इस तरह परिभाषित करते हैं - बाएं शिफ्ट
-
सकारात्मक पूर्णांकों को रोमन संख्याओं में बदलने के लिए जावास्क्रिप्ट प्रोग्राम
ह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ो एक सकारात्मक रोमन संख्या लेता है और अपना रोमन प्रतिनिधित्व देता है। निम्नलिखित मान जिनका उपयोग हम धनात्मक पूर्णांकों के लिए रोमन संख्याएँ सेट करने के लिए करेंगे - const legend = { 1: 'I', 2: 'II', 3: 'III', 4: 'IV', 5: 'V
-
जावास्क्रिप्ट में संख्याओं के भार के अनुसार छँटाई
किसी संख्या का भार उस संख्या के अंकों का योग होता है। उदाहरण के लिए - The weight of 100 is 1 The weight of 22 is 4 The weight of 99 is 18 The weight of 123 is 6 ह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ो संख्याओं की एक सरणी लेता है। फ़ंक्शन को संख्याओं को उनके भार के बढ़ते क्रम में क्रमबद्ध करना चाह
-
जावास्क्रिप्ट में अंतरिक्ष से अलग किए गए तत्वों की आवृत्ति की गणना के लिए कार्य
मान लीजिए कि हमारे पास एक स्ट्रिंग है जिसमें कुछ अक्षर इस तरह से व्हाइटस्पेस से अलग किए गए हैं - const str = 'a b c d a v d e f g q'; ह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ो एक ऐसी स्ट्रिंग लेता है। फ़ंक्शन को ऑब्जेक्ट्स की एक आवृत्ति सरणी तैयार करनी चाहिए जिसमें अक्षर और उनकी गिनती हो। उ
-
जावास्क्रिप्ट में सरणी के भीतर विखंडित सरणी
हमें एक JavaScript फ़ंक्शन लिखने की आवश्यकता है जो पहले तर्क के रूप में संख्याओं की एक सरणी और दूसरे तर्क के रूप में एक एकल संख्या, जैसे num लेता है। संख्या हमेशा सरणी की लंबाई से कम या उसके बराबर होगी। फ़ंक्शन को एक नई सरणी तैयार करनी चाहिए जिसमें उप-सरणियों की संख्या होनी चाहिए। यदि सरणी की लंबाई
-
जावास्क्रिप्ट में बाइनरी सरणियों को जोड़ने के लिए एल्गोरिदम
द्विआधारी जोड़ की मूल बातें - बाइनरी जोड़ के चार नियम हैं - 0 + 0 = 0 0 + 1 = 1 1 + 0 = 1 1 + 1 = 10 इन बिंदुओं को ध्यान में रखते हुए, द्विआधारी जोड़ दशमलव जोड़ के समान है (जो कैरी सिद्धांत का पालन करता है)। हमें एक जावास्क्रिप्ट फ़ंक्शन लिखने की आवश्यकता होती है जिसमें दो सरणियाँ होती हैं जिनमें
-
जावास्क्रिप्ट में दो सरणियों का सबसेट
हमें एक JavaScript फ़ंक्शन लिखने की आवश्यकता है जो शाब्दिक के दो सरणियों में लेता है। इन बातों को ध्यान में रखते हुए, फ़ंक्शन को यह निर्धारित करना चाहिए कि दूसरी सरणी पहले सरणी का सबसेट है या नहीं - array1 के सभी मानों को array2 में परिभाषित किया जाना चाहिए यदि सरणी 1 में डुप्लिकेट मान मौजूद ह
-
जावास्क्रिप्ट में लक्ष्य मान के योग के सभी जोड़े खोजें
हमें एक JavaScript फ़ंक्शन लिखने की आवश्यकता है जो पहले तर्क के रूप में संख्याओं की एक सरणी और दूसरे तर्क के रूप में एक लक्ष्य योग संख्या लेता है। फ़ंक्शन को सरणी से उन सभी संख्याओं की एक सरणी वापस करनी चाहिए जो दूसरे तर्क द्वारा निर्दिष्ट लक्ष्य योग में जोड़ते हैं। हम जोड़े की जांच करने के लिए मा
-
जावास्क्रिप्ट में एकल लिंक की गई सूची से तत्वों को हटा दें
मान लीजिए, हमारे पास इस तरह एक सिंगल लिंक्ड लिस्ट है - const list = { value: 1, next: { value: 2, next: { value: 3, next: {  
-
जावास्क्रिप्ट में एक सरणी के भीतर प्रत्येक सरणी का औसत खोजें
हमें एक JavaScript फ़ंक्शन लिखने की आवश्यकता है जो संख्याओं की सरणियों की एक सरणी लेता है। फ़ंक्शन को एक नई सरणी बनानी चाहिए, प्रत्येक उप-सरणी के लिए औसत की गणना करनी चाहिए और इसे नए सरणी में संबंधित सूचकांकों पर धकेलना चाहिए। मान लें कि निम्नलिखित हमारी सरणी है - const arr = [ [1], &n